Starbucks Culture In India At Pace

Starbucks India

Why Starbucks? To some people, the success of Starbucks in India is a bit of a mystery.  The first store was started in 2012 and now, the total numbers of stores are 78. However much you like the coffee, there’s no denying it’s expensive, not just compared to traditional filter coffee but even compared to the other Western-style café chains throughout the country. What is it about Starbucks that has customers lining up outside the … Read more